Output ed067898bf81f3e7df9f1bdb44f5543547e9c1e7085c2e324fa5e410ebaf9418:1

value
37821148500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8873fced37af290d80d33fe87e4fdfbf63c474a OP_EQUAL
address
3QM7XQAtxas1bu9zGiSyVfDbKpDKxiXp2p
transaction
ed067898bf81f3e7df9f1bdb44f5543547e9c1e7085c2e324fa5e410ebaf9418
spent
true